               TITLE 22--FOREIGN RELATIONS AND INTERCOURSE
 
               CHAPTER 15--THE REPUBLIC OF THE PHILIPPINES
 
           SUBCHAPTER I--LAWS AND OBLIGATIONS OF UNITED STATES
 
                         Part 1--Customs Duties
 
Secs. 1251 to 1255. Omitted


                          Codification

    Section 1251, act Apr. 30, 1946, ch. 244, title II, Sec. 201, 60 
Stat. 143, provided for entry of Philippine articles into the United 
States, between May 1, 1946 and July 3, 1954, free of ordinary customs 
duty.
    Section 1252, act Apr. 30, 1946, ch. 244, title II, Sec. 202, 60 
Stat. 143. Subsec. (a), related to ordinary customs duties on Philippine 
articles between July 4, 1954 and July 3, 1974. Subsec. (b), which 
related to ordinary customs duties on Philippine articles for the period 
after July 3, 1974, was omitted on authority of former section 1345 of 
this title which nullified subchapter I of this chapter upon the 
expiration of the revised agreement between the United States and the 
Republic of the Philippines which occurred on July 4, 1974.
    Section 1253, act Apr. 30, 1946, ch. 244, title II, Sec. 203, 60 
Stat. 144, related to customs duties on Philippines articles other than 
ordinary customs duties. See note above for section 1252(b) of this 
title.
    Section 1254, act Apr. 30, 1946, ch. 244, title II, Sec. 204, 60 
Stat. 144, related to equality in special import duties. See note above 
for section 1252(b) of this title.
    Section 1255, act Apr. 30, 1946, ch. 244, title II, Sec. 205, 60 
Stat. 144, related to equality in duties for products of the Philippines 
which did not come within the definition of Philippine articles. See 
note above for section 1252(b) of this title.


          Extension of Duty-Free Period Until December 31, 1955

    Act July 5, 1954, ch. 459, 68 Stat. 448, provided that the duty-free 
treatment of this section was to be applied in lieu of section 
1252(a)(1), (2) of this title for Philippine articles entered or 
withdrawn from United States warehouses for consumption during periods 
between July 3, 1954 and December 31, 1955 provided the President 
declared by proclamation that such period was one in which United States 
articles were admitted into the Philippines free of ordinary customs 
duties.

     Proc. No. 3060. Extension of the Period of Duty-Free Treatment

    Proc. No. 3060, July 10, 1954, 19 F.R. 4397, provided that United 
States articles entered or withdrawn from warehouse in the Philippines 
for consumption, during the period from July 4, 1954 to December 31, 
1955, be admitted into the Philippines free from ordinary customs duty.
